A week ago I took responsibility for a sweet girl that was mauled by 2 Great Pyrenees. She wasn’t my dog at the time. Took her to the vet, they sutured her up very crudely  gave me antibiotics and some pain killers.
Later that night she was crashing. Her vitals were dropping, temperature dropped, she was going into shock.
I drove 40 miles with her to the Emergency Veterinary. I have stood vigil ever since, paying as she kept trying to improve.  A week later, I had to have her hind leg amputated. She is still in a very guarded situation.  The owners finally surfaced and said they couldn’t afford her. They have a very large family. I found out they didn’t fix the area where she was getting out, or knew exactly where it was.They have since relinquished her to me. I just felt she needed a chance. What I didn’t realize at the time, don’t know if it would have made a difference, was just how much her bill would be. I’m still hanging in there with her. I can’t throw her away.
